21xrx.com
2024-11-22 07:36:11 Friday
登录
文章检索 我的文章 写文章
C++数据库课程设计
2023-07-05 03:16:33 深夜i     --     --
C++ 数据库 课程设计

在计算机科学中,数据库是一种常见的数据管理方法,应用广泛。C++是一种高级程序设计语言,它非常适合进行数据库课程设计。通过使用C++语言,我们可以创建一个完整的数据库系统,并实现各种基本的操作功能。

数据库课程设计的目的是让学生了解如何设计和管理数据库系统,以及如何使用现代数据库系统解决实际问题。在C++数据库课程设计中,我们需要考虑以下关键点:

1. 数据结构设计

在C++数据库课程设计中,我们需要选择最适合我们需求的数据结构。这通常包括表、记录、索引、视图等。我们还需要确定每个数据结构的各种属性,例如数据类型、大小、约束等。

2. 数据库管理

在C++数据库课程设计中,我们需要实现各种功能来管理我们的数据库。这包括数据库连接、创建、删除、备份、恢复和维护。我们还需要实现安全机制,例如用户验证和访问控制。

3. 数据库查询

在C++数据库课程设计中,我们需要实现各种查询功能,例如通用查询、嵌套查询、联合查询和子查询等。我们还需要实现聚合函数,例如平均、最大、最小和求和等。

4. 数据库编程

在C++数据库课程设计中,我们需要实现各种编程功能,例如存储过程、触发器和自定义函数等。这些功能可以大大增强我们的数据库系统的灵活性和可扩展性。

总之,C++数据库课程设计要求我们具备扎实的C++编程基础,熟悉数据库设计和管理,了解SQL语言和常见的数据库编程方法。通过参与C++数据库课程设计,我们可以掌握现代数据库技术,深入了解数据库系统的运作原理,培养创新思维和实践能力。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复